Fans are thrilled by reports that Kathryn Hahn is being considered to play Mother Gothel in Disney’s upcoming live-action remake of Tangled. The project was initially revealed in 2024, and Deadline reports Hahn is currently in discussions for the role.

The classic animated film from 2010 centers around Rapunzel, a princess with magical, healing hair. As a baby, she was kidnapped by Mother Gothel, who locks her away in a tower and uses Rapunzel’s powers to remain young herself.

Before Patricia Hahn was cast, Scarlett Johansson was also considered for the part of Mother Gothel, but she had to drop out because of issues with her filming schedule.

The upcoming live-action movie has cast Teagan Croft, known for her role in Titans, as Rapunzel, a character previously voiced by Mandy Moore. She’ll star alongside Milo Manheim from Zombies, who will play the charming thief Flynn Rider – a role previously voiced by Zachary Levi.
